Crystec is pleased to announce that the company will be attending the BIO International Convention 2026, taking place from 22–25 June 2026 in San Diego.
During the event, Crystec CEO Paul Thorning will be meeting with biotech and pharmaceutical companies to discuss how Crystec’s proprietary modified supercritical anti-solvent (mSAS®) particle engineering platform can address complex drug development challenges.
Crystec works with companies developing both small molecule and large molecule therapeutics, helping to enhance bioavailability, improve dissolution performance, optimise stability, and enable more effective drug delivery. The company’s mSAS® technology offers precise control over particle size, morphology, and solid-state properties, supporting the development of difficult-to-formulate drug candidates across a range of therapeutic areas and delivery routes.
